There IS one requirement that must be met for a fuel to be considered a biofuel.

That is?

A) the starting material must be CO2 that can be fixed or turned into other molecules.
B) the biomass is produced year after year through sustainable farming practices.
C) it does not harm ecosystems, contribute to acid rain, or worsen global warming.
D) they do not produce any greenhouse gases when used.

Answer:- A. the starting material must be carbon dioxide that can be fixed or turned into other molecules.

Explanations:- By carbon fixation process, carbon dioxide is converted to organic compound that could be used as a fuel to generate energy.
